黑木耳多糖的提取、纯化及降血脂作用的研究 被引量:57

Studies on the Extraction,Purification and Hypolipidemia Activity of Auricularia Auricular Polysaccharides

摘要 为明确黑木耳多糖的组分及其生理功能,以复合酶法对黑木耳多糖进行了提取,并以柱层析法对其进行了纯化;以纯化的黑木耳多糖喂饲大鼠,考察了其降血脂的功能。通过试验得到两种黑木耳多糖,即APE I和APE II;各剂量的APE I对大鼠体重没有显著影响;100mg/kg体重及以上的APE I可以显著降低高脂大鼠血清的TG、TC、LDL-C水平,提高其HDL-C水平;200mg/kg体重的黑木耳多糖对高脂大鼠血清的TG、TC、LDL-C和HDL-C的影响与70mg/kg体重的脂必妥的效果没有显著差异,并能够显著提高高脂血症大鼠的HDL-C/TC水平。黑木耳多糖(APE I)具有降血脂功能,对高脂血症的发生有一定的预防作用,同时对冠心病和动脉粥样硬化也有一定的预防作用。 In order to determine the polysaccharide composition and its physiological function of Auricularia auricular, combined enzymes were used to extract the polysaccharide of A uricularia auricular, which was then purified by column chromatography, and the hypolipidemia activity was studied by feed rats. Two fractions of Auricularia auricular polysaccharides (APE), APEⅠ and APEⅡ were obtained, APEⅠ had no obviues effect on the body weight of rats; at the dose of 100 mg/kg body weight and above, APEⅠ can significantly reduce the serum TC, TG and LDL-C levels and enhance the HDL-C levels in hyperlipidemia rats; at the dose of 200 mg/kg body weight, APEⅠ had similar effects on the levels of serum TG, TC, LDL-C and HDL-C of hyperlipidemia rats with Zhi-bi-tuo capsule (70 mg/kg body weight), and enhanced the levels of HDL-C/TC significantly. It is concluded that APEⅠ, one of the polysaccharides from A uricularia auricular, had hypolipidemia activity, and can prevent hyperlipemia, coronary disease and atherosclerosis.
